Most Do-Not-Call laws allow businesses and other entities to make telephone solicitations to certain consumers regardless if their number may appear on a Do-Not-Call list. Generally, these exceptions apply to (1) businesses with an “Established Business Relationship” with the consumer; (2) a consumer who has specifically consented to allow the business to call them; (3) charitable organizations; and (4) political entities. A cookie is a piece of data tied to information about the user and stored on the user’s computer. We use both session cookies, which terminate when a user closes his/her browser, and persistent cookies, which remain on the user’s computer until manually deleted. We use session cookies to make it easier for you to navigate the Site. Persistent cookies also enable us to track and target the interests of our users to enhance and personalize the experience on the Site. We do not link the information we store in persistent cookies to any personally identifiable information that you submit while on the Sites.
